MERCEDES-BENZ SL CLASS (2008-12)

Buyer's Guide & Data from our Checks

The MERCEDES-BENZ SL CLASS (2008-12) is a luxury convertible known for its stylish design and impressive driving experience. Positioned in the premium sports car segment, it appeals to those seeking a combination of comfort, performance, and sophistication. In the UK market, it stands out as a desirable choice for enthusiasts and those looking for a statement vehicle, often used for leisure drives, special occasions, or as a weekend car. From the mycarcheck.com data, over 2,000 checks reveal its popularity among buyers, with an average valuation of around £15,300 and a typical mileage of about 49,000 miles. Most owners have kept it for a few years, averaging three previous owners, which suggests reasonable reliability and interest from multiple drivers. Its high resale value and consistent usage highlight its reputation as both a reliable and aspirational vehicle.
